They are qualified of eating their very own weight every day in raw raw material. Where are they found? - Red worms prey on dead plants and animals and are commonly discovered in fallen leave litter, manure stacks or from a neighborhood lure shop. What do they resemble? - Red worms are two to four inches in length and red in shade.
The red worms will tunnel with and digest the bed linens together with the food scraps to generate vermicompost. They will certainly not crawl out of their container unless the bin becomes also dry or too damp. Location Red worms are most effective at eating natural matter and replicating when they are maintained damp and well aerated in a temperature level variety of 55 75 F.

The vermicomposting process takes 4-8 weeks (depending on the dimension of the container) before all the bedding and waste will transform into humus, completion product - compost worms. The end product of vermicomposting will certainly contain worm castings (manure), decomposed bed linen, and worms and small microorganisms dead and active. The humus can be contributed to potting mix for houseplants or the end item and worms can be placed in the garden to enrich the dirt

Stay clear of very check my source bright areas regarding much sun can get too hot the container which will certainly prepare the worms. If you want your worms to go on making compost throughout the winter months, it might be needed to situate them in a shed or garage where temperatures do not drop below cold. As the climate obtain colder watch on the bins to make certain the worms are still active and damaging down the raw material.
Over time, the feeding price will come to be faster as your worm populace increases. Feed your worms little and commonly.

No, earthworms are a different varieties and they are not adjusted to living in fresh organic product like the tiger/ brandling worms.
The little white worms you see on the food on the surface of your container are called Enchytraeids. They won't hurt your bin or the compost worms.
